Red Robyn Crafts was borne out of my desire to create felt books for my kids, Thomas and Isabelle. A life-long crafter, I’m always on the hunt for a new project and I stumbled upon an amazing (and seriously addictive!) new hobby when I discovered the world of felt books. At night, I would sit and create pages to suit their current interests and skills, and in the morning they would awake to find the latest page inserted in their soft-covered books. I always found that they enjoyed the interactive pages best, and I revelled in the challenge to make aeroplanes fly, cars race about a page, flowers grow, trucks lift heavy loads, and crocodiles brush their teeth, all through the medium of felt and a hot glue gun!
Whenever we were out and about, the kids would entertain themselves with their latest pages and my friends would ask me where I bought the book. It gradually dawned on me that perhaps others would benefit from my patterns so that they could create these mini works of art for their kids too! And so, after countless hours of designing, pattern making, stitching, gluing, planning, photographing and instruction writing, the first few patterns were developed.
My intention is to create a series of felt book collections, beginning with the Nursery Rhyme Collection. Every pattern will be designed to be either stitched or glued, they will involve some level of interactivity to help develop fine-motor skills and hand-eye coordination, and they'll be fun to make and play with.
I hope you enjoy creating these felt book pages as much as I've enjoyed creating the patterns.

Can I ask you questions prior to purchasing a pattern?
YES! Please do ask any questions you'd like clarified before you make any purchases. I'd hate for you to purchase and download a file you don't want, so please ask first then purchase.
I'm looking for a specific pattern but I can't see it here. Do you custom make patterns?
I know the feeling! I have a million pattern ideas floating about in my head that I'd love to have completed! In general, I can't make custom patterns (or I'd never finish the collections I've already started), but if you have an idea that you'd like me to work on, please send it to me and I just might incorporate it into one of the collections :)
I've spotted a cheeky little mistake in one of your patterns. Would you like to know about it?
Yes! Please email me if you spot any mistakes or unclear instructions. I've read the instructions countless times, but mistakes always slip through (especially on the 1am read-throughs!)
I've purchased one of your patterns and now I'd like to pass a copy (digital or hard copy) along to my friends. Are you cool with this?
No, I'm not! I wasn't lying about those 1am read-throughs. Every single pattern takes weeks of work with the pattern design, stitching, gluing, instruction writing, re-stitching, photography, more re-stitching, videography, and a final re-stitching for good luck. I love creating them and sharing them with a wider audience, but please respect the work that has been put into them and each pay for your own patterns.
I'd like to use your patterns to make and sell felt books. Are you cool with this?
Yes! If you are a small-scale, crafty soul who likes to sell handmade items at a local market, you are most welcome to use my patterns, but I do ask that you credit me (Red Robyn Crafts) on the tag/packaging.
